Introduction to KAI Token
KardiaChain’s native token, KAI, is at the heart of a blockchain designed for interoperability. Its mission is to bridge diverse blockchain ecosystems, creating a unified platform for decentralized applications (dApps) and enhancing accessibility. With a capped total supply of 5 billion tokens, KAI has captured attention due to its integration of Web3, AI, and NF3 technology for real-world applications.

Trading Opportunities with KAI
A. KAI/WETH Liquidity Pools
Liquidity pools on platforms like Balancer.fi allow users to deposit assets like KAI and Wrapped Ethereum (WETH) to earn trading fees and rewards. Here’s how to evaluate the potential:
- Advantages of Pairing KAI and WETH:
- Earning Trading Fees: A portion of each trade’s fees is distributed to liquidity providers.
- Exposure to Two Assets: Gain exposure to KAI and WETH, which could benefit from long-term growth.
- Balancer Rewards: Check if the pool is incentivized with BAL token rewards for extra yield.
- Risks:
- Impermanent Loss: Price divergence between KAI and WETH can reduce returns.
- Low Trading Activity: Limited trading volume for KAI may lead to fewer fees and lower profitability.
- Volatility: As a smaller token, KAI is more susceptible to price fluctuations compared to WETH.

How to Analyze Potential Investments in KAI
- Liquidity Assessment:
- KAI’s liquidity is lower than larger-cap tokens, leading to potential price slippage during trades. This should factor into your strategy for providing liquidity or trading.
- Correlation to Broader Markets:
- As KAI integrates more Web3 and AI technologies, its correlation to the blockchain market’s growth trends may increase.
- Rewards from Liquidity Pools:
- Platforms like Balancer.fi often reward LPs (liquidity providers) with both pool fees and governance tokens. Pairing KAI with WETH in a weighted pool (e.g., 80/20) could mitigate risks while optimizing exposure.
